This is a Sources Sought notice.

The agency is gauging market interest. No bid is being requested yet — submitting a capabilities statement may put you on the radar for the eventual solicitation.

The Department of Veterans Affairs needs a Service-Disabled Veteran-Owned Small Business to develop a patient elopement tracking system.

Key Details

What exactly do they need? - The Department of Veterans Affairs needs a patient elopement tracking system. - The system must track patient elopements in real-time.

What's the contract structure and timeline? - The notice doesn't say.

How will they pick the winner? - The notice doesn't say.

When and how do you bid? - The response deadline is June 22, 2026, at 2:00 PM EST. Bids must be submitted through SAM.gov.
